What is an Upper Body Lift?
An upper body lift is a group of exercises that are designed to improve your upper body strength, size, and muscle tone. These exercises include targeted exercises that target the shoulders, chest, upper back, arms, and abs. When combined and performed together, these exercises work concomitantly to provide you with a complete workout that can help you to achieve better results. Some good examples of upper body lift exercises include bench press, push ups, shoulder raises, chin ups, tricep dips, and bicep curls.
